A 25-hectare estate on Turtle Bay, built around the ruins of an 18th-century powder mill, with seven restaurants, a 9-hole golf course and its own equestrian centre.
Maritim Resort & Spa Mauritius sits on 25 hectares at Balaclava, on the sheltered north-west coast. The grounds are built around the Ruins of Balaclava, an 18th-century French powder mill and national monument, and run down to the calm water of Turtle Bay.
The resort keeps its own working farm alongside the beach: an equestrian centre with horses and ponies, giant tortoises, and a 9-hole golf course threaded through the gardens. Seven restaurants and five bars, several set inside the old stone buildings, cover everything from a colonial-style buffet to a fine-dining room in a restored mansion.

A working equestrian centre, a 9-hole golf course, and a 3,500 sqm spa set beside a waterfall — all within the estate.

Fifteen treatment rooms across 3,500 sqm of garden, with a romantic waterfall, two ayurveda rooms and three saunas.

A par-29 course within the grounds, free for guests to play, with driving range and putting green included.

Nine horses and two ponies, plus a small animal farm and giant tortoise park, open to beginners and experienced riders alike.
